3步搞定B站视频下载:免会员解锁4K高清画质
【免费下载链接】bilibili-downloaderB站视频下载,支持下载大会员清晰度4K,持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ader
还在为无法保存心仪的B站视频而苦恼吗?想离线收藏UP主的精彩作品却受限于平台规则?现在,通过bilibili-downloader这个强大的B站视频下载工具,你只需要简单的3个步骤,就能轻松实现高清视频的永久保存。
🎯 为什么你需要这款下载神器
画质突破:无需B站大会员身份,直接下载4K超高清视频,告别画质限制操作极简:一次配置,长期有效,下载过程全自动化资源丰富:支持普通视频、分集内容、充电专属视频等多种类型效率倍增:异步并发下载技术,让下载速度提升数倍
🚀 快速开始:3步完成视频下载
第1步:获取工具并安装依赖
首先确保你的电脑已安装Python 3.6或更高版本,然后执行以下命令:
git clone https://gitcode.com/gh_mirrors/bil/bilibili-downloader cd bilibili-downloader pip install -r requirements.txt第2步:配置Cookie解锁会员内容
这是下载大会员专属视频的关键步骤:
- 在浏览器中登录你的B站账号,打开任意视频页面
- 按F12打开开发者工具,切换到"网络"标签页
- 刷新页面,在请求列表中找到第一个请求
- 在请求头中找到Cookie字段,复制其中的SESSDATA值
将复制的SESSDATA值粘贴到config.py文件的COOKIE字段中,注意这个值大约30天需要更新一次。
第3步:添加链接并开始下载
在config.py文件的URL列表中添加你想要下载的视频链接:
URL = [ 'https://www.bilibili.com/video/BV1xx123456', 'https://www.bilibili.com/video/BV1xx654321', # 继续添加更多视频链接... ]保存配置后,运行命令开始下载:
python main.py💡 高级用户必知的实用技巧
分P视频精准下载
想要单独下载多分P视频中的特定部分?只需在链接后添加分P参数即可:
# 下载第2个分P 'https://www.bilibili.com/video/BV1xx123456/?p=2'批量下载高效管理
将多个视频链接整理到URL列表中,工具会自动按顺序下载,并显示详细的进度信息。
清晰度智能选择
工具会自动检测并选择最优画质进行下载,支持从流畅到4K的所有清晰度等级。
🛠️ 常见问题与解决方案
下载位置:所有视频默认保存在项目根目录的output文件夹中临时文件:下载过程中产生的临时文件会自动清理网络优化:支持自定义并发下载数量,避免网络拥堵
📁 项目结构与核心文件
- 配置文件:config.py - 包含Cookie设置和下载链接列表
- 主程序:main.py - 程序入口,控制完整下载流程
- 数据模型:models/ - 视频和分类的数据结构定义
- 策略模块:strategy/ - 实现不同的下载策略和逻辑
🎉 立即开始你的下载之旅
现在你已经掌握了bilibili-downloader的完整使用方法。无论是收藏学习资料、保存UP主精彩作品,还是离线观看番剧,这款工具都能完美满足你的需求。
记住:下载内容仅限个人学习使用,请尊重原创者的劳动成果。建议定期检查工具更新,以获取最新功能和性能优化。
官方文档:README.md 核心源码:main.py 配置说明:config.py
【免费下载链接】bilibili-downloaderB站视频下载,支持下载大会员清晰度4K,持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考